Dubrovnik, Freedom of Choice. This morning, let the story of Dubrovnik's Golden Age unfold before your eyes as you tour the main sights of the Old Town, including Onofrio's Fountain, Rector's Palace and Prijeko Street. You'll also visit Dubrovnik's Old Pharmacy and the War Memorial Museum. Later this afternoon, perhaps embark on an excursion to Lokrum Island, located just off the coast. Alternatively, take a walking tour along the ancient city walls and delight in the wonderful views. Tonight, enjoy a Welcome Dinner at a local restaurant. BD AN EXCURSION TO MONTENEGRO Day 3. Kotor, Budva. Enjoy a trip today into Montenegro, a small country that boasts a stunning coastline and mountainous landscapes. Tour the Venetian-influenced port of Kotor, which is surrounded by an impressive city wall. Then continue to the popular 3,500 year-old settlement of Budva, famous for its sandy beaches and Mediterranean architecture. Afterwards, return to Dubrovnik. B VISIT BOSNIA & Herzegovina Day 4. Dubrovnik, Mostar. After breakfast, travel across the Croatian border into Bosnia & Herzegovina and on to the city of Mostar, situated on the Neretva River. On arrival, check in to your hotel then learn about Mostar's fascinating history during a guided sightseeing tour. Afterwards, enjoy dinner. Two Night Stay: Mostar, Hotel Bristol. BD Day 5. Sarajevo. Today journey to Sarajevo, the capital of Bosnia & Herzegovina. Historically famous for its traditional religious diversity, Sarajevo was nearly destroyed during the Bosnian War of the 1990s but has since recovered to become a genuinely welcoming and enthralling city to explore. On arrival here, you'll embark on a guided sightseeing tour taking you to the sights along the Miljacka River, which runs through the heart of town. B Day 6. Mostar, Split, Freedom of Choice. Travel back into Croatia and on to Split today. On a tour, see Split's ancient architecture, its harbour and Diocletian's Palace, one of the most imposing Roman ruins in existence. You'll also visit the Old Roman Square, Peristil, the Cardo Decumanus streets, and more. Tonight, choose to dine at your hotel or in a local restaurant, the Adriatic Graso. Overlooking the sea, this restaurant offers delicious Dalmatian slow-cooked dishes. Stay: Split, Radisson Blu Resort Split. BD Day 7. Split, Plitvice Lakes National Park.
